My Favorite Movie

From the myriad of films that have captivated my attention over the years, there is one movie that has consistently resonated with me on a deep emotional level. It is "The Shawshank Redemption," a 1994 film directed by Frank Darabont, based on the novella by Stephen King.
What sets "The Shawshank Redemption" apart from other movies is its compelling narrative and the powerful character development. The story revolves around Andy Dufresne, a successful and intelligent banker who is wrongfully convicted of murder and sentenced to life in Shawshank State Penitentiary. Over the years, Andy forms an unbreakable bond with his fellow inmate, Ellis "Red" Redding, and they both navigate the harsh realities of prison life together.
One of the reasons why this movie is my favorite is because of its ability to portray the indomitable human spirit. Despite the overwhelming odds against him, Andy never loses hope and remains determined to prove his innocence. His resilience and unwavering optimism serve as an inspiration to all who watch the film.
The character development in "The Shawshank Redemption" is truly remarkable. Both Andy and Red are beautifully crafted, with complex backstories and personal growth throughout the film. The chemistry between the actors, Tim Robbins and Morgan Freeman, is undeniable, making their on-screen relationship feel authentic and genuine.
Moreover, the film's setting, the imposing and oppressive atmosphere of Shawshank Prison, perfectly complements the story's themes of injustice, corruption, and redemption. The cinematography and score further enhance the emotional impact of the movie, drawing the audience into the lives of these characters.
What I admire most about "The Shawshank Redemption" is its timeless message of hope and the belief that even in the darkest of times, there is always a glimmer of light to be found. The movie has a unique way of making its audience reflect on their own lives and the power of perseverance.
In conclusion, "The Shawshank Redemption" is my favorite movie because of its profound storytelling, compelling characters, and powerful message. It is a film that I can watch time and again, and each time, I find myself moved by its emotional depth and the hope it offers. It is a testament to the human spirit's ability to overcome adversity, and for that, it will always hold a special place in my heart.
